I need it for my '92 RS. I've searched high and low and I couldn't find so much as a part number.

I'm not sure if it's one cable or if it's two cables with one that connects to the tranny and another coming from the cluster and both these cables hook up in the middle. Either way, no junkyards around my area have it. If anyone has one in working condition, let me know.

Re: [WTB] Speedometer cable

Posted: January 21st, 2012, 10:05 pm
by Evo_Spec
it'll be a single cable thing that goes from your tranny to the cluster and there'll be a hole in the firewall for it and a grommet on the cable to plug the hole
any car with an F-series tranny should work, like the 323.
